Amparo Lopez










Missing Person Case September 2021



Missing Person Case September 2021


Lopez, approximately 2009




Date reported missing : 04/23/2009

Missing location (approx) :
Laredo, Texas
Missing classification : Endangered Missing
Gender : Female
Ethnicity :
Hispanic
Age at the time of disappearance: 32 years old
Height / Weight : 5'5, 175 pounds
Medical conditions : Lopez was eight and a half months pregnant at the time of her disappearance. She also suffers from diabetes and high blood pressure.
Distinguishing characteristics, birthmarks, tattoos : Hispanic female. Brown hair, hazel eyes. Lopez's ears are pierced. She may use the last name Lopez-Sanchez.





Information on the case from local sources, may or may not be correct : Lopez was last seen when she went to a doctor's appointment at a health clinic on Cedar Street in Laredo, Texas. She disappeared after she left the appointment. Her car was found in the clinic parking lot with the door and window open and her cellular phone inside.
Lopez has never been heard from again. She left behind a one-year-old daughter. Her case remains unsolved.

A missing person is a person who has disappeared and whose status as alive or dead cannot be confirmed as their location and condition are not known. A person may go missing through a voluntary disappearance, or else due to an accident, crime, death in a location where they cannot be found (such as at sea), or many other reasons. In most parts of the world, a missing person will usually be found quickly. While criminal abductions are some of the most widely reported missing person cases, these account for only 2�5% of missing children in Europe. By contrast, some missing person cases remain unresolved for many years. Laws related to these cases are often complex since, in many jurisdictions, relatives and third parties may not deal with a person's assets until their death is considered proven by law and a formal death certificate issued. The situation, uncertainties, and lack of closure or a funeral resulting when a person goes missing may be extremely painful with long-lasting effects on family and friends.
